Abstract

Problem statement: Issues pertaining to women's protection rights have ignited social debate within the framework of the mak dijuk siang tradition. This tradition, upheld by the indigenous people of Lampung, forbids divorce and conveys the moral message that marriage is sacred, noble, and honourable, thus necessitating its preservation until death separates the couple. Objective: This study seeks to investigate the underlying reasons for the conflicting values associated with the mak dijuk siang tradition among the indigenous Lampung community, as well as to evaluate the relevance of this tradition in the heterogeneous social context of the indigenous Lampung populace. Methods: A qualitative approach was employed for this study. Primary data were collected through interviews with a diverse range of informants, including community leaders, traditional leaders, and community members from the sub-districts of Anak Tuha, Gunung Sugih, and Bumi Ratu Nuban in Central Lampung Regency. Theories of justice and gender served as the analytical framework for data analysis. Results: The findings indicate that the prevailing social reality, which prioritises the protection of women and human rights, has led to a debate between traditional and contemporary values concerning the mak dijuk siang tradition. The middle ground in this value debate advocates for a dialectic between the principles of justice and equality in gender relations, grounded in human rights. Conclusion: The fact that women are seeking divorce through the Religious Court in an area with strong traditional ties to this practice demonstrates that the tradition is no longer uniformly upheld. This study advocates for the local government to continue recognising and promoting local customs that possess positive values for family resilience.

Abstract

This study investigates the dual influence of ChatGPT and Self-Regulated Learning (SRL) strategies on the academic writing performance of students in Arabic Language Education programs. With the increasing integration of artificial intelligence tools in higher education, it is essential to understand how these technologies interact with traditional learning strategies, particularly in writing scholarly theses in Arabic—a language that presents unique structural and stylistic challenges. The primary objective of this study is to evaluate the extent to which ChatGPT and SRL affect students’ ability to produce well-structured and linguistically accurate Arabic bachelor's theses. A quantitative survey method was employed, involving 56 students across three academic semesters. Data analysis was conducted using SmartPLS 4.0 to measure the impact of both variables. The findings indicate that both ChatGPT and SRL significantly enhance students' thesis writing skills. Notably, ChatGPT has a slightly greater influence, particularly in the areas of idea development, content organization, and advanced language use. Meanwhile, SRL remains crucial for time management, intrinsic motivation, and reflective evaluation. These results underscore the complementary roles of AI assistance and self-regulated strategies in academic writing. The study contributes to the growing discourse on the ethical and pedagogical implications of AI in education, particularly in the context of Arabic language scholarship. It recommends a balanced pedagogical model that integrates AI tools like ChatGPT with structured SRL frameworks to optimize student performance and uphold academic integrity.

Abstract

This study examines the contention around Islamic boarding school women's view of wives' rights in polygamous marriages. It aims to answer academic questions, specifically how and why there is contention among Islamic boarding school women over the rights of wives in polygamy. Furthermore, it also aims to answer what consequences this contestation has for the practice of polygamy, which is common in Islamic boarding schools. This paper is an empirical research that takes a sociological perspective. The analysis is based on Pierre Bourdieu's Cultural Sociology theory. Data were gathered through an interview study with research subjects from five traditional Islamic boarding schools in Lampung Province. The findings of this study show that the contestation of wives' rights in polygamy is influenced by the level of understanding of religious texts and norms, social and economic realities, and the strength of the patriarchal traditions and systems that surround it. Most women are denied the opportunity to fight for their bodily and spiritual rights, both before and after polygamous marriage occurs. Women in Islamic boarding schools recognize that men's supremacy influences the neglect of women's rights in polygamy because their understanding of religious texts is conservative. Women have no bargaining power when their husbands seek to practice polygamy. Conservatives believe that polygamy is a fate and consequence that women who want to marry a caregiver or an Islamic boarding school leader (Kyai) must accept. A moderate perspective necessitates that polygamy be practiced with proportional rights between husband and wife. The repercussions of this contestation have resulted in a better appreciation of the importance of men's and women's rights being proportionate, as well as mutual protection.

Abstract

This article presents an in-depth study of the movements of Shalat (Islamic prayer) as a form of spiritual epistemology, particularly from the perspective of the concept of Nur Muhammad. This research adopts a qualitative approach with a descriptive-analytical method, designed to carefully explore and interpret the symbolic meanings contained within each posture and transitional movement of Shalat. Its primary objective is to understand how this series of physical movements functions as an effective means of acquiring profound and authentic spiritual knowledge. The study's findings reveal significant insights: each movement in Shalat represents systematic and essential stages in the human spiritual journey towards closeness with God. This spiritual journey is fundamentally rooted in the concept of Nur Muhammad, understood as the primordial light of creation, the first entity created by Allah, and the origin of all manifestations in the universe. Thus, Shalat is not merely a ritual, but a symbolic "mi'raj" (ascension) that allows the worshipper to align themselves with this original light. This research is expected to make a substantial contribution to deepening the understanding of the esoteric and philosophical dimensions of Shalat, moving beyond its literal interpretations. Furthermore, this study also aims to enrich the treasury of Islamic epistemology by offering a new perspective on how the practice of worship can become a path towards the acquisition of intuitive and direct Divine knowledge.

Abstract

Human life is getting easier with new discoveries, both in the fields of science and technology. One of the advantages of this progress is that individuals get information easily and quickly, but in fact this actually increases life competition even harder. This problem can be solved by implementing social education according to Al-Qur'an and Al-Sunnah. The aim of this research is to compare and relate the concept of social education in Islam from the perspective of Ahmad Rajab Al-Asmarī and Muḥammad Al-Syādzilī. This research is library research in the form of descriptive analysis. The data is collected by using primary sources, namely the Al-Nabī Almurabbī Book and the Usus Al-Tarbiyah Al-Ijtimāiyah fī Al-Islām Book, while secondary sources are obtained through books, journals, or others that discuss research problems. Al-Asmarī emphasized the importance of the example of Prophet Muhammad as the basis for social education, while Al-Syādzilī emphasized the importance of Islamic social principles implemented through formal educational institutions and public policies. According to Al-Asmarī, social education focuses on the formation of morals and manners with the aim of forming individuals with noble character in accordance with the example of Prophet Muhammad. Meanwhile, according to Al-Syādzilī, the social education process can be used to form a just society by applying Islamic principles in all aspects of social, political and economic life. Regarding developments over time, Al-Asmarī still adheres to a traditional approach which is based on implementing established values without much modification. However, Al-Syādzilī emphasized the importance of adapting to social changes and modern challenges
